Details

This page combines information on two similar guitars: a pair of Gibson semi-hollows in Natural (also known as Blonde) finish.

One of the earliest clear sightings of the first guitar appears in a photo by Justin Downing1: it is an ES-335 with Bigsby B7 vibrato, dot neck, short pickguard and Grover tuners. The photo was taken in Spring 2025 for the launch of new signature chukka boots by Novesta, designed in collaboration with Noel in support of Teenage Cancer Trust.

It definitely looks like a modern reissue - maybe a Gibson Memphis model from the mid 2010s or a more recent "Made To Measure"2, custom-ordered (and artificially aged) model.

During the Live '25 tour, it is being kept backstage as a backup to Noel's main #1 ES-355.3 More info about the reunion gear in this blog post.

The other guitar - an original ES-345 model from 1972 - has never been seen as of today. It was bought by Noel in Chicago in April 2012:

"Had a day off here yesterday. Bought myself a new guitar!! Hadn't bought one in a couple of years. A beauty it is too. A blonde Gibson 345, 1972, quite rare."4

It's quite a rare sight indeed — only a small number of Natural (Blonde) Gibson semi-hollows were produced before the more recent wave of reissues.

At first, I considered the possibility that Noel might have mixed up the models and was actually referring to a 1972 Natural ES-335 instead of an ES-345. But that theory doesn't hold up: 1972 ES-335s featured a different headstock shape and block inlays on the neck. So, as far as we know, the ES-335 seen in the 2025 photo is not the same guitar Noel bought in Chicago back in 2012.
